Nate Berkus and husband Jeremiah Brent to star in TLC show

the design star takes on reality TV

Nate Berkus and his husband Jeremiah Brent will be starring in “Married to Design: Nate & Jeremiah” on TLC.

Berkus and Brent will be redesigning people’s homes who are in need of a makeover on the reality series.

‘Design isn’t just what we do for a living, it’s what we do on our weekends,” Berkus says in a press release. “So this show is perfect. We get to have all the fun and the homeowner gets rescued from a money pit that is consuming them. They’re lost. We’re not. We know where to save, where to spend, where to shop … it’s what we love most.”

The couple, who married in 2014 and are parents to one-year-old Poppy, will also give an intimate look at their private lives.

“I just stood in a room with the people we love the most and watched as our daughter blew out the candles on her 1st birthday cake,” Brent continues in the release.

“Aside from the fact that I was an emotional wreck, I found myself looking at Nate and the two of us not being able to contain all the joy and gratitude that is our life right now. To invite people to see that side of us, it just feels right,” Brent says.

‘Heated Rivalry’ stars to participate in Olympic torch relay

Games to take place next month in Italy

“Heated Rivalry” stars Hudson Williams and Connor Storrie will participate in the Olympic torch relay ahead of the 2026 Winter Olympics that will take place next month in Italy.

HBO Max, which distributes “Heated Rivalry” in the U.S., made the announcement on Thursday in a press release.

The games will take place in Milan and Cortina from Feb. 6-22. The HBO Max announcement did not specifically say when Williams and Storrie will participate in the torch relay.
